Transaction 77cd98524691794999e20efb132e6effe3ea54b8bb24454b9192daa5ff834cbd
1 Input
1 Output
-
77cd98524691794999e20efb132e6effe3ea54b8bb24454b9192daa5ff834cbd:0
- value
- 130275055
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a7ab53589292e9c1a82e7d4e23c9ec8ccf98a3e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16LDC1yvhrXesb1dbYX3CDfKVujtfngEHb